Translingual
Etymology
From Ancient Greek λεκάνη (lekánē, “dish, pot, pan, basin”). (This etymology is missing or incomplete. Please add to it, or discuss it at the Etymology scriptorium.)
Proper noun
Lecanora f
- A taxonomic genus within the family Lecanoraceae – the rim lichens.
Hypernyms
- (genus): Eukaryota – superkingdom; Fungi – kingdom; Dikarya – subkingdom; Ascomycota – phylum; Pezizomycotina – subphylum; Lecanoromycetes – class; Lecanoromycetidae – subclass; Lecanorales – order; Lecanoraceae – family
